CAPPUCCINO PIE
This rich and indulgent no bake dessert recipe, frozen Cappuccino Pie, is the ultimate summer treat! It's an easy pie recipe that's always a crowd pleaser!
Provided by Heather of Kitchen Concoctions: https://www.kitchen-concoctions.com
Categories Dessert- Pie/Cobbler
Time 5h25m
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- For Chocolate Cookie Crust: Place cookies in food processor and blend until fine cookie crumbs are formed. Add melted butter, and pulse food processor 3-4 additional times. Spray a 9-inch deep dish pie plate with baking spray and press the cookie crumb mixture into the bottom and up the sides of the pie plate. Place pie plate in freezer to chill for 10-15 minutes.
- For Cappuccino Pie: Chill a large metal or glass bowl and wire whisk in the freezer for 15 minutes.
- Meanwhile, in a large bowl, whisk together milk, coffee, pudding mix and ½ cup heavy cream. Set aside.
- Add remaining 1½ cups heavy cream, powdered sugar and vanilla to chilled bowl. Using a large hand-held whisk or an electric mixer, whip cream until it begins to thicken. Continue to whip cream until soft peaks begin to form. Use caution and do not over mix.
- Fold half of the whipped cream mixture into the pudding mixture, being careful not to over mix. Pour pie filling into prepared pie crust and store remaining whipped cream in refrigerator until ready to serve.
- Place pie in freezer and freeze for 4-6 hours, or until frozen. When ready to serve, remove pie from freezer and let sit at room temperature for 15 minutes.
- Meanwhile, place 8-10 chocolate sandwich cookies in food processor and blend until large cookie crumbs are formed.
- Right before slicing, spread remaining whipped cream on top of pie and top with large cookie pieces. Slice and serve immediately.

CAPPUCCINO MOUSSE PIE
This is very r-i-c-h due to the amount of whipping cream, but well worth the splurge. The recipe came from my mom's collection of clippings, from a magazine. For a change, I have made this without the crust - just layering the filling(s) in clear glasses ( I actually used those mini plastic wine glasses for a large crowd. I also have been known to add 2 tablespoons of coffee liquer to the whipping cream mixture before beating. Feel free to garnish with whipped cream & chocolate curls (and fresh raspberries if you have any). NOTE: Cooking time=chilling time.
Provided by Sweet PQ
Categories Pie
Time 40m
Yield 1 pie, 8 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Melt chocolate chips - either in the microwave, 1-1 1/2 minutes, or stovetop in a small double boiler. Mix whipping cream, coffee granules, sugar and vanilla (and coffee liquer if you are using) in a large bowl until the coffee granules dissolve. Beat with electric mixer on high until stiff peaks form when beaters are lifted.
- Remove & reserve 1 1/2 cups of the coffee whipped cream.
- Gently fold the melted chocolate into the remaining whipped cream until well blended. Spread this evenly in the crust.
- Spread and swirl the coffee whipped cream over the mousse. Chill until set. This will take at least 1 hour in the refrigerator, or 30 minutes in the freezer.
- Garnish & serve.
